Salt Lake City nominated ‘Best Ski Town’
Salt Lake City, Utah — USA Today nominated Salt Lake City n their 2021 Travel Awards “Best Ski Town” in the United States.
The city was selected by an expert panel, according to a release from Visit Salt Lake.
The contest criteria include proximity to skiing, city atmosphere, and amenities such as restaurants, entertainment, and bars.
Voting ends Monday, November 22 and winners will be announced on Friday, December 3rd.
Voters have four weeks to narrow the list of 18 cities and towns down to the 10 Best. Voters can vote once per day.

The nomination of Salt Lake shouldn’t surprise locals who have unprecedented access to The Greatest Snow on Earth®. Downtown, is just a 35-minute drive to Big and Little Cottonwood canyons were Alta, Snowbird, Brighton, and Solitude. Each average 500” of Utah’s famous powder each winter.
“We’re excited that the world is discovering what we’ve always known – that we ARE the best Ski Town with the Greatest Snow on Earth®. Our new international airport and newly open airport TRAX station make it easy to access amazing skiing and riding the same day you fly in,” said Kaitlin Eskelson, President & CEO of Visit Salt Lake. “Salt Lake is more modern, progressive, and vibrant than travelers realize and we’re eager to showcase the local community, the people who live and work here and make it a better place.”
